FORT WORTH – Fort Worth Opera announces that it will produce a world premiere opera as part of its 2010 Festival. The opera, Before Night Falls, is by Jorge Martín, a Cuban-American composer relatively new to the operatic stage; Before Night Falls will be his first major world premiere.

Fort Worth Opera Studio, a training program for upcoming artists, will produce Amahl and the Night Visitors, this holiday season with four performances in Fort Worth and one in Longview, Texas as part of Opera East Texas’ 2007 Season.

Fort Worth Opera announced that it will continue the festival format for the 2008 Season in Bass Hall and that it will add a fourth production to be performed at the Scott Theatre, a small, 481-seat theatre located in the Arts District of Fort Worth. Fort Worth Opera revamped its format in 2007, from a fall/winter schedule to a four-week festival held in May-June.

Fort Worth Opera announced that it will offer complimentary child care during its opera performances for the inaugural 2007 Festival. The service will be available for Friday and Saturday evening performances and will be complimentary for all season ticket holders with children from 6 months to 11-years-old.

Fort Worth Opera's 60th Anniversary celebration will be a very special one, as it marks a new beginning for the company's presentations. The oldest continually performing opera company in Texas is completely revamping its format from a fall/winter schedule to a condensed three-week festival from May 19 through June 10.
